FACILITY NOTES
Published May 11, 1998
In DC, Mike Cleary reports that the MCI Center has
"spurred or accelerated" many of the projects in the eastern
part of downtown DC. The arena has also "brought a new wave
of patrons" to the area (WASHINGTON TIMES, 5/11)....Work
crews will begin dismantling the retractable roof at Olympic
Stadium today. The process, to be completed in December,
will cost Quebecers C$180M, much of it in repairs, to
replace it with a C$37M permanent roof (TORONTO STAR, 5/11).
...Int'l Speedway Corp. (ISC) showed plans Friday for its
proposed, $200M Kansas Int'l Speedway. The new track will
sport condominiums, a restaurant and a museum and should
closely resemble the Las Vegas Motor Speedway (K.C. STAR,
5/9)....Harbor Yard, the new minor league park for the
Bridgeport (CT) Bluefish will cost taxpayers about $17M
instead of the projected $14M (HARTFORD COURANT, 5/11).
